The energy crisis, growth in data traffic and increasing network complexity are driving the development of energy-efficient architectures, technologies and networks. This edited book presents research from theory to practice, plus methods and technologies for designing next generation green wireless communication networks.


List of contents











  • Chapter 1: Introduction

  • Part I: Mathematical tools for energy efficiency

    • Chapter 2: Optimization techniques for energy efficiency

    • Chapter 3: Deep learning for energy-efficient beyond 5G networks

    • Chapter 4: Scheduling resources in 5G networks for energy efficiency



  • Part II: Renewable energy and energy harvesting

    • Chapter 5: Renewable energy-enabled wireless networks

    • Chapter 6: Coverage and secrecy analysis of RF-powered Internet-of-Things

    • Chapter 7: Backscatter communications for ultra-low-power IoT: from theory to applications

    • Chapter 8: Age minimization in energy harvesting communications



  • Part III: Energy-efficient techniques and concepts for future networks

    • Chapter 9: Fundamental limits of energy efficiency in 5G multiple antenna systems

    • Chapter 10: Energy-efficient design for doubly massive MIMO millimeter wave wireless systems

    • Chapter 11: Energy-efficient methods for cloud radio access networks

    • Chapter 12: Energy-efficient full-duplex networks

    • Chapter 13: Energy-efficient resource allocation design for NOMA systems

    • Chapter 14: Energy-efficient illumination toward green communications

    • Chapter 15: Conclusions and future developments
